Documents Required for a BIS Certification for Passport Reader
The BIS Registration for Passport Reader requires applicants to publish a set of files that prove the authenticity of the manufacturer, product details, and compliance with Indian requirements. Those documents help the Bureau of Indian Affairs verify that the passport reader is secure, reliable, and eligible for use in India.
- BIS Software Form: Properly filled form with whole information of the applicant, manufacturer, and product model.
- Business License: Proof of the corporate existence of the producer or importer.
- Manufacturing Unit Address: Application bills, lease agreements, or property possession files of the manufacturing unit.
- Product Technical Files: Detailed product description, circuit diagram, block diagram, and specs of the passport reader.
- Test Reviews from BIS-Diagnosed Lab: Reports displaying compliance with Indian protection and quality requirements.
- ISO 9001 Certificate of the Manufacturer: To affirm that the agency follows standard quality management systems.
- Authorization Letter: If the application is filed by means of an agent or authorized consultant.
- Trademark Registration or Emblem Authorization Letter: To validate the emblem ownership or usage rights.
- Import-Export Code (IEC certificate): Required for importers bringing passport readers into India.
- Packing Listing and Invoices: Industrial documents associated with cargo or import (if relevant).
- Copy of Preceding Certifications (ifany): Consisting of worldwide approvals or earlier BIS certificate.
- Undertaking and Declarations: Signed statements confirming product compliance and authenticity of records.
- Product Sample: In a few cases, a sample may be requested for trying out and verification by way of the lab.
Process for Obtaining BIS Registration for Passport Reader
The process of acquiring a BIS certification for Passport Reader entails several vital steps to ensure that the product complies with Indian safety and standards. This certification is obligatory for manufacturers and importers before selling passport readers in India.
- Identify the Relevant Indian Standard: Determine the precise BIS under which the passport reader falls.
- Filling Application: Submit a duly filled BIS utility form along with all required documents.
- Submission of Product Samples: Provide passport reader samples to a BIS-identified laboratory for testing.
- Product Testing: The sample is examined for safety, performance, and compliance with BIS requirements.
- Assessment of Factory Files: BIS review of the producing facility details, quality control practices, and technical documents.
- Inspection (if required): In some instances, BIS officers may also conduct a manufacturing unit inspection to verify techniques and production potential.
- Examination of test reports: The take a look of effects from the BIS-recognized lab is cautiously reviewed.
- Grant of BIS Certification: As soon as the product passes checking out and documentation is tested, the BIS certificates for Passport Reader are issued.
- Marking and Labeling: After certification, the BIS general Mark (ISI Mark) needs to be displayed on the product, as in keeping with BIS suggestions.
- Renewal and Compliance: The certificate needs to be renewed periodically, and manufacturers have to keep following BIS norms.
